[Hiring] Customer Care Specialist @Enable Dental

Remote Full-time
Role Description

Join Enable Dental as a Customer Care Specialist and become the friendly voice that welcomes our patients into a seamless and caring dental experience! We’re passionate about bringing quality dental care directly to our patients, and your role is crucial in making every interaction positive and memorable.

In this engaging position, you’ll connect with patients, assist them with scheduling appointments, answer questions with clarity and empathy, and collaborate with our team to ensure every detail is handled with care. If you have a heart for helping others and love communicating in a dynamic environment, you’ll thrive here.
• Be the first point of contact for patients through phone, email, and chat—answering questions and providing guidance with warmth and professionalism.
• Manage scheduling and appointment logistics, making sure our mobile dental teams are efficiently routed and patients feel cared for.
• Handle billing inquiries and assist patients with payment options, making the process simple and stress-free.
• Maintain accurate patient records and communicate seamlessly with clinical and operations teams.
• Help educate patients about the benefits of mobile dental care and inspire confidence in our services.
• Contribute ideas to enhance customer care processes and elevate patient satisfaction.

Qualifications
• A high school diploma or equivalent;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ree is a plus.
• At least 2 years of customer service or call center experience, preferably within healthcare.
• Exceptional communication skills with an empathetic and engaging approach.
• Strong problem-solving abilities and attention to detail.
• Comfortable working with CRM software and office tools.
• Ability to multitask and th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
• Passion for helping others and delivering excellent patient experiences.
• Bilingual in English and Spanish is highly preferred.
• Availability to work 8am-5pm PST.

Benefits
• Enjoy a comprehensive benefits package that includes Medical, Dental, Vision coverage.
• A 401(k) plan (with 3% match).
• Life Insurance.
• Generous Paid Time Off to help you recharge and thrive.

Compensation: $18/hr
